Cleaning the Media Path
Wipe away any ink or grime on the media path and other areas as part of the daily cleaning pro-
cedure. It is easy for ink or grime to ax to the media path, and, if le unaended, this will con-
taminate new media and have a negave eect on the transport of media when it is output. Pinch
rollers, grit rollers, and the platen are parcularly prone to the buildup of grime.
WARNING
Never use a solvent such as gasoline, alcohol, or thinner to perform clean-
ing.
Doing so may cause re.
CAUTION
Beforeaempngcleaning,switchothesubpowerandwaitunlthe
heateranddryercool(approximately30minutes).
Sudden movement of the machine may cause injury, or hot components may
cause burns.
IMPORTANT
• This machine is a precision device and is sensive to dust and dirt. Perform cleaning on a daily basis.
• Never aempt to oil or lubricate the machine.
Clean by wiping with a cloth moistened by neutral detergent diluted with water then wrung dry.
Pinch roller
These are the posions where the media is xed in place or transported, so it is
easy for ink and grime to ax to these posions. Failure to clean this part properly
may result in the transfer of grime to the surface of media.
Grit roller
These are the posions where the media is xed in place or transported, so it is
easy for grime to ax to these posions. Remove buildup of media scraps and
other material using a brush. Never use a metal brush.
Platen
Wipe away any buildup of ink, grime, or cut media on the media path and in the
grooves.
